November 2008 HAT Progress Report
The main news on traffic has been the closure of the 1040 between Church End and Papworth from the 3rd - 12th November for road surfacing and repairs and its effect on the village.
Residents in the Graveley Way area were adversely affected due to traffic being diverted in order to join the 1198 and onwards .The volume and speed was considerable - not helped by the lack of visible speed signs, also making lengthy waits for access from homes and several near misses. One person had a journey to Papworth lasting 45 minutes .
Also , and seriously, a number of HGVs used Graveley Way illegally . Police were informed but were not able to take action .
Several HGVs and large vehicles failed to read the Road Closed signs ,or chose to ignore them , arrived at the Church End turn needing to turn with difficulty then severely churned up the triangle of grass .For example , one Italian fruit and vegetable HGV driver found himself in that predicament - maybe he did not understand the earlier signs ! HAT has been assured by the team leader that it will be made good. It does all emphasise the continuing HGV problem and the need to guard the effect of the future A14 on the village as much as we are able .
On the plus side people living close to the 1040 enjoyed 10 days of the kind of peace villagers love and pedestrians likewise , we could even hear birds singing ( but also the A14 traffic even more .)
